Echarts 地圖是一個強大的數(shù)據(jù)可視化庫,可以用來展示各種各樣的地理信息。在使用 Echarts 地圖時,有時我們需要加載本地 JSON 數(shù)據(jù),這時就需要用到一些特殊的方法。
以下是一個簡單的示例,展示如何加載本地 JSON 數(shù)據(jù)到 Echarts 地圖中:
var myChart = echarts.init(document.getElementById('chart'));
myChart.showLoading();
$.getJSON('mapdata.json', function (data) {
myChart.hideLoading();
echarts.registerMap('myMap', data);
myChart.setOption({
series: [{
type: 'map',
map: 'myMap'
}]
});
});
在上述示例中,我們通過echarts.init
方法初始化了圖表,并通過showLoading
方法顯示了加載動畫。接著,我們使用 jQuery 中的$.getJSON
方法加載本地 JSON 數(shù)據(jù),等數(shù)據(jù)加載完成后通過hideLoading
方法隱藏加載動畫。
之后,我們使用了registerMap
方法來注冊地圖,這個方法會把地圖數(shù)據(jù)加載到 Echarts 中。最后,我們使用setOption
方法設置了圖表的選項,包括使用注冊的地圖。
在以上步驟完成后,我們就可以在 Echarts 地圖中展示本地 JSON 數(shù)據(jù)了。